IEEE Trans Cybern. 2021 Jan;51(1):393-404. doi: 10.1109/TCYB.2019.2963138. Epub 2020 Dec 22.
In this article, we propose a key secret-sharing technology based on generative adversarial networks (GANs) to address three major problems in the blockchain: 1) low security; 2) hard recovery of lost keys; and 3) low communication efficiency. In our scheme, the proposed network plays the role of a dealer and treats the secret-sharing process as a classification issue. The key idea is to view the secret as an image during the secret-sharing process. If the user's private key is text, we can covert the key text into an image called the original image. Specifically, we first divide the original image into original subimages by the image segmentation. Next, we encode each original subimage by DNA coding. Finally, we train the proposed network to find the key secret-sharing results. Our proposed scheme is not only a significant extension of the GANs but also a new direction for the key secret-sharing technology. The simulation results show that the scheme is secure, and both flexible and efficient in communication.
在本文中,我们提出了一种基于生成对抗网络(GANs)的关键秘密共享技术,以解决区块链中的三个主要问题:1)安全性低;2)丢失密钥的难以恢复;3)通信效率低。在我们的方案中,所提出的网络充当经销商的角色,并将秘密共享过程视为分类问题。关键思想是在秘密共享过程中将秘密视为图像。如果用户的私钥是文本,我们可以将密钥文本转换为称为原始图像的图像。具体来说,我们首先通过图像分割将原始图像分割为原始子图像。接下来,我们通过 DNA 编码对每个原始子图像进行编码。最后,我们训练所提出的网络以找到关键秘密共享结果。我们提出的方案不仅是 GANs 的重要扩展,也是关键秘密共享技术的新方向。仿真结果表明,该方案安全可靠,在通信方面具有灵活性和高效性。